Top 5 Card Battler Apps on Android in Turkey for Q2 2023
The top 5 card battler apps on Android in Turkey for Q2 2023 show varied trends in downloads, revenue, and active users, providing insights into their market performance.
During Q2 2023, the top 5 card battler apps on the Android platform in Turkey exhibited diverse performance trends across downloads, revenue, and active users.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, offers valuable insights into the market dynamics of these popular games.
Legends of Runeterra saw a general decline in revenue throughout the quarter, starting from $9.0K at the end of March and dropping to around $679 by mid-June, before experiencing a significant spike to $5.0K in the final week. Downloads rem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 1.1K to 1.7K weekly, with a peak of 1.8K in the last week of June. Weekly active users showed a modest increase from 8.9K to 9.6K by the end of the quarter.
Hearthstone demonstrated a peak in revenue in mid-April at $6.8K, followed by a decline to $852 by mid-June, with a slight recovery to $2.2K at the end of June. Downloads varied significantly, reaching a high of 2.7K in mid-May and dipping to 454 in mid-June. Active users peaked at 7.3K in mid-May but decreased to 4.8K by the end of the quarter.
Mighty Party experienced a gradual decline in revenue, starting from $2.9K at the beginning of April and falling to approximately $1.2K by the end of June. Downloads also showed a downward trend, from a high of 2.9K in late April to 648 by the end of June. Active users decreased from 34.1K in late April to 20.0K by the end of the quarter.
MARVEL SNAP had fluctuating revenue figures, starting at $2.6K in early April, with a notable peak of $1.9K in early June, ending at around $976 in late June. Downloads peaked at 3.0K in mid-June and were as low as 584 in late April. Active users remained strong, peaking at 47.3K in late May but slightly declining to 34.8K by the end of June.
Animation Throwdown: Epic CCG had relatively stable revenue, ranging between $277 and $710 throughout the quarter. Downloads data was only available for late May and early June, showing figures of 398 and 312, respectively. Active users increased from 251 in late March to a peak of 519 in early June, ending the quarter at 260.
